Output 912671c55287862148b5b687a3ae57ec0b44f159dc5d0d6ce99ba948ca9f8a49:57

value
42139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04db75f4b19faa2b09ae8b2ad0777e7f080fa64 OP_EQUAL
address
3HmDx8S2M2sjovANgNzoGLExEHK3sZMgE3
transaction
912671c55287862148b5b687a3ae57ec0b44f159dc5d0d6ce99ba948ca9f8a49
spent
true